Show Indirect Fees | Indirect fees are fees that were paid to a third party and are being recorded by the clerk but for which the clerk did not
receive any direct payment. Select this check box to show indirect fees. These fees are identified with ![]() |

Fee Schedule | This column displays a description and date of the fee schedules for the selected party. Click ![]() ![]() The schedules are sorted in ascending order based on the priority of the associated fee category. If there is more than one
fee category with the same priority, they are sorted alphabetically.
Within each fee category, fees are sorted ascending alphabetically based on the fee description.

Charges | This column shows the total of the charge transactions for the fee schedule. When you increase charges, the balance increases.
Charges cannot be adjusted below zero.
Right-click an adjusted fee and select Reset to restore that fee to its original amount.
|
||||||
Payments | This column shows the total of the payment transactions for the fee schedule. You cannot make changes to these amounts unless
you are signed on to a till.
When you increase payments, the balance decreases and escrow increases. Payments cannot be adjusted below zero.
Right-click an adjusted fee and select Reset to restore that fee to its original amount.
|
||||||
Credits | This column shows the total of the credit transactions for the fee schedule. When you increase credits, the balance decreases.
Credits cannot be adjusted below zero.
Right-click an adjusted fee and select Reset to restore that fee to its original amount.
|
||||||
Balance | This column is equal to Charges minus Payments minus Credits. You cannot edit this column. | ||||||
Disb (disbursements) | This column displays the total of the disbursement transactions for the fee schedule or code. You cannot edit this column. | ||||||
Escrow | This column is equal to Payments minus Disbursements. You cannot edit this column. | ||||||
Current Adjustments | This line shows the relative change made during the adjustment. If no changes were made to a column, “None” is displayed here in black. If changes have been made but the net effect is zero, “0.00” is displayed. An increase to the column is displayed in green, while a decrease is displayed in red. | ||||||
Adjusted Totals | This line shows the adjusted fee total for all fee schedules (excluding indirect fees). | ||||||
